Littleton , NH — A free event for Veterans seeking guidance on the PACT Act of 2022 (also known as the Sergeant First Class Heath Robinson Honoring Our Promise to Address Comprehensive


Toxics Act) takes place April 19, 2024, from 10:00 a.m. – 2:00 p.m. at VFW Post 816 in Littleton, New Hampshire. This event is hosted by Veteran Affairs (VA) and the Vet Center. Expert


personnel will be available to help Veterans understand what the PACT Act means for them, their loved ones, and their fellow Veterans and servicemembers. This event comes after VA announced


that all Veterans who were exposed to toxins or other hazards while serving in the military – at home or abroad – became eligible to enroll directly in VA health care beginning March 5,


2024. This means that all Veterans who served in the Vietnam War, the Gulf War, Iraq, Afghanistan, the Global War on Terror, or any other combat zone after 9/11 will be eligible to enroll


directly in VA health care without first applying for VA benefits. Additionally, Veterans who never deployed but were exposed to toxins or hazards while training or on active duty in the


United States will also be eligible to enroll. Highlights of this legislation include: * Expanding and extending eligibility for VA health care for Veterans with toxic exposures and Veterans


of the Vietnam era, Gulf War era, and Post 9/11 Veterans * Adds more than 20 new presumptive conditions for burn pits and other toxic exposures * Adds more presumptive locations for Agent


Orange and radiation exposure * Provides toxic exposure screenings to every Veteran enrolled in VA health care * Helps us improve research, staff education, and treatment related to toxic


exposures VETERANS, SERVICEMEMBERS, AND SURVIVORS ARE STRONGLY ENCOURAGED TO APPLY NOW FOR THEIR PACT ACT BENEFITS.  Conditions caused by toxic exposures have taken a serious toll on many


Veterans and their families. As of August 10, 2022, the date the bill was signed into law, VA considers all conditions established in the PACT Act to be presumptive. For a “presumptive


condition” Veterans do not need to prove that their service caused the condition.  Any Veteran or survivor can learn more about the PACT Act by visiting VA.gov/PACT or calling
